AOTW: Max Robinson - Cross Country
By JASON PLUSH | November 15, 2013For the first time in over 50 years, the Hopkins men’s cross country team captured the Centennial Conference Championship. While there have been a variety of contributors that have been crucial to the team’s success this year, the most consistent and dominant runner on the team has been senior captain Max Robinson. Robinson led the way again this past weekend at the Conference Championships where he took third place overall. He has been a leader all year long for the cross country team, and his relentless determination has helped him to finish well in every race regardless of the teams he faced. As a result of his great success The News-Letter has awarded Robinson with the Athlete of the Week title. We were able to catch up with the star distance runner to ask him a few questions about the season and the team’s preparation for the NCAA playoffs.
